Thanks, Eya.
To my surprise we actually have a report from the Danish press from the session today - it's otherwise politics 24/7 these days here in DK.
https://www.bt.dk/kendte/norsk-prins...rinsesseboksen
As you know the press were not allowed to ask questions or take photos during the session.
Around 70 people had shown up for The Princess and the Shaman, Activation Divinity.
They were told to look deep in the eyes of the one sitting next to them, while chanting: "Let your light grow." And realize they were in reality looking at themselves.
Durek told them it was about quantum physics (!!) and about being ambassadors of love.
Combined with deep breaths, some of the participants smiled, others teared up.
All the participants were Scandinavian women, aged 8-70 or so.
People let go of their shoes and relaxed while Shaman gave his lecture, danced around, whooping and ML talked about breaking out of "your box" that other are trying to put you in, and about being in contact with yourself.
ML talked about how she never felt she belonged in the royal family, and didn't fit into the princess-box. She was too wild, too fond of action and couldn't reconcile herself with her duties as princess.
She joked: "I dreamed that my real parents would one day come and take me with them."
She told about how she broke away from the NRF and how the public reaction was. How she was called crazy and laughed at.
"I cannot recognize what the press is writing about me. They try to put me into a box, but I don't want to go in there."
There were several journalists present among the 70 attendees, all having paid 950 DKK. (70 X 950 DKK = 66.500 DKK = roughly 10.000 $)
Durek told them he wouldn't let the press ruin his internal energy.
He talked about how the press often use doctors and other professionals to take apart his methods. But the doctors don't understand him, because they don't understand his world. They insist on putting him into a box.
He went on:
"My world is free of prejudice. A logic person would examine shamanism. An illogical and ignorant person simply determine that my methods cannot work.
That's how you limit the society. That's how societies die."
